1. 强化身份认证机制
暴力破解攻击的核心目标是获取服务器登录凭证。启用多因素认证(MFA)可增加第二层防护屏障,即使密码泄露,攻击者仍无法通过动态验证码或生物识别认证。同时应强制实施密码策略:
- 密码长度不少于12位,包含大小写字母、数字和特殊符号
- 禁止使用常见弱密码和重复密码
- 设置90天强制更换周期
2. 网络访问控制策略
通过阿里云安全组实现最小化开放原则:
- 仅开放业务必需端口(如HTTP/80、HTTPS/443)
- SSH/RDP等管理端口限制为可信IP段访问
- 启用云防火墙自动拦截异常请求
协议类型 | 端口范围 | 授权对象 |
---|---|---|
SSH | 22 | 企业办公网IP段 |
HTTP | 80 | 0.0.0.0/0 |
3. 系统安全加固
及时更新系统补丁可消除已知漏洞带来的攻击面。建议配置自动更新策略,并通过以下措施降低风险:
- 禁用root账户直接登录
- 修改SSH默认端口
- 安装入侵检测系统(IDS)实时监控异常行为
4. 监控与应急响应
阿里云日志服务可记录所有登录尝试行为,建议设置告警规则:
- 同一IP连续5次登录失败触发告警
- 非工作时间段登录行为监控
- 异常进程创建告警通知
发现攻击时应立即阻断来源IP,并通过快照功能进行系统盘备份。
防御暴力破解需要构建多层次安全体系,从身份认证、网络隔离、系统加固到动态监控形成完整闭环。定期开展渗透测试和安全审计,结合阿里云原生安全产品,可显著提升服务器防护等级。